Germany calls Baku, Yerevan for prompt resumption of talks

03 November 2023 16:03

Participation in the Global Gateway program can bring Azerbaijan and Armenia closer.

German Foreign Minister Annalena Baerbock told reporters, Report says.

The Global Gateway stands for sustainable and trusted connections that work for people and the planet. It helps to tackle the most pressing global challenges, from fighting climate change, to improving health systems, and boosting competitiveness and security of global supply chains.

She noted that the European Union, including Germany, is ready to support Yerevan and Baku. “Germany and the European Union want to work together for stability in the South Caucasus.”

According to the minister, both sides must now adhere to the path of mutual trust.

Baerbock noted that Germany stands for the early resumption of negotiations between Baku and Yerevan.

“Germany stands for lasting peace, political and economic diversification of the region, close and good relations with Europe. Establishing trust and peace in the region is very important. The main goal is to ensure peace through negotiations.”

German Foreign Minister Annalena Baerbock will visit Yerevan and Baku on 3-4 November. Baerbock is expected to hold talks with Armenian and Azerbaijani Foreign Ministers Ararat Mirzoyan and Jeyhun Bayramov respectively and give joint news conferences.
